It doesn't have to be religious if you're not into that, but someplace special you can go to be alone and relax. Not your office, where there is work to do, someplace where you can quiet your mind. Even just your front porch and putting a special pillow in your chair can make it a sacred space.
I use music a lot to help set up a sacred space. Awake Nation is a wonderful channel to listen to, and the higher vibrations are supposed to cleanse your body and area of negative energy and fill it with healing.
Maybe light a scented candle to set the mood, burn some incense, or use essential oils. Whatever makes you happy and relaxed.
Now, I don't know if you have done this already, but it can help! Start journaling. You can just get your thoughts out of your head, or start a gratitude journal or a dream journal. I know you've got pretty pens and notebooks, so you should have fun with this!
If you have the time, meditate. It doesn't have to be long, or sitting there thinking about nothing. Which is impossible by the way. It's just a way to clear out the bad thoughts and bring in good thoughts. I like the channel on YouTube Great Meditation. They have five and ten-minute meditations so it doesn't take long and may help your mind settle and focus.
Or you can use a prop for meditation. Like in this Meditating with Amethyst to Harmonize Mind and Spirit. You have that amethyst, use it!
There is also another way of meditation called Grounding and Centering. This can help you be balanced and hopefully get some energy into you. Who knows? It might help.
Here's something you can do in the bathroom if you can get it for some private time. Some Pagans do a Spiritual Bath to get rid of the negative energy in our lives and bring in good. Some salts, herbs or flowers, and essential oils in the bath can make it feel wonderful. Add a cup of tea and some calming music and it'll be like a spa!
Now this last one I'm going to suggest is a little out there. It's a spell but you can consider it an evening meditation or something. It's a little spell for Finding Inner Peace. All you need is a white votive or tea candle in a fire-safe dish and some time. It's really easy and may help you feel better.
